Handbags Born of Old Leather Jackets

Potrero bag

A company born of passion, based on the concept of upcycle rather than brand new, reMade USA makes handbags that hit the eco target.

The San Francisco-based company creates one-of-a-kind stylish, sophisticated bags out of recycled leather jackets and scrap materials sourced from thrift stores and car and furniture upholstery companies. They also accept donations from anyone with unwanted leather lying around the house.

On the Cuff: Found Objects Regenerate Flower Power

artcuffs-spring-2009-joan-davis-art-studios

Noted Bay Area artist Joan Elan Davis is still working her magic with flowers – but this time she has moved them off the canvas and planted them skillfully onto the wrist. At least that is where they pop and bloom when you buckle on one of her new cuffs introduced for spring 2009. Aren’t they the grooviest? I love the marriage of the elements she has employed.
